簡體   English   中英

如何使用Visual Studio 2012在IIS 8.0中部署WCF Web服務?

[英]How to deploy a WCF web service in IIS 8.0 using Visual Studio 2012?

我陷入困境,無法弄清楚如何在iis8.0中部署wcf Web服務,請問有誰可以幫我解決在iis中部署wcf Web服務的詳細過程?

是否需要設置任何設置?

嘗試過的是.......

然后我通過提供站點名稱和物理路徑(C:\\ inetpub \\ wwwroot \\ NEWFOLDER)在iis中創建了一個新網站。 然后我以管理模式打開VS解決方案發布它。 在打開的對話框中,在IIS站點下創建一個新的Web應用程序並將其發布。 它很成功,也可以在輸出窗口中看到。

當點擊連接到http:// localhost:[port#] / WebApplicationName的行的鏈接時,它會顯示目錄結構。 然后單擊.svc文件,它會顯示錯誤“由於擴展​​配置,無法提供您請求的頁面。如果頁面是腳本,請添加處理程序。如果要下載文件,請添加MIME映射

您的服務器上未安裝WCF Servive處理程序。

在服務器管理器中

  • 展開“.Net 3.5”或“.Net 4.5”,具體取決於Os / Framework版本。

  • 在“WCF服務”下,選中“HTTP激活”(用於http綁定)或“非HTTP”用於其他綁定(tcp,命名管道等)的框。

  • 單擊“安裝”按鈕。

就這樣

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M